Spelling & Dictionary Insight

A purely visual mix-up. lacet (\la.sɛ\) and lucet (\ly.sɛ\) are said differently, so reading them aloud is the quickest way to catch the wrong one. On the page they stay close: they differ by a single letter - a in “lacet” becomes u in “lucet”.
